4. Muhammad ibn Yahya has narrated from al-Hassan ibn Ali al-Daynawariy from Muhammad ibn ‘Isa from Salih ibn ‘Uqbah who has said the following
“Once I visited Jamil ibn Darraj while he was at a beautiful table having food. He said, ‘Come and join us for food.’ I said, ‘I am fasting.’ He continued eating until very little food remained. He then insisted that I discontinue my fast. I said, ‘Why did you not insist before?’ He said, ‘I wanted to discipline you.’ He then said, ‘I heard abu ‘Abd Allah (a.s.), say the following. “If a fasting person visits his brother (in belief), who offers him food, and he accepts the offer without telling him about his fast, in order not to show that he is doing him a favor by accepting his offering food, Allah, majestic is whose mention, counts his fast as one year’s fasting.’””
4ـ مُحَمَّدُ بْنُ يَحْيَى عَنِ الْحَسَنِ بْنِ عَلِيٍّ الدِّينَوَرِيِّ عَنْ مُحَمَّدِ بْنِ عِيسَى عَنْ صَالِحِ بْنِ عُقْبَةَ قَالَ
دَخَلْتُ عَلَى جَمِيلِ بْنِ دَرَّاجٍ وَبَيْنَ يَدَيْهِ خِوَانٌ عَلَيْهِ غَسَّانِيَّةٌ يَأْكُلُ مِنْهَا فَقَالَ ادْنُ فَكُلْ فَقُلْتُ إِنِّي صَائِمٌ فَتَرَكَنِي حَتَّى إِذَا أَكَلَهَا فَلَمْ يَبْقَ مِنْهَا إِلاَّ الْيَسِيرُ عَزَمَ عَلَيَّ أَلاَّ أَفْطَرْتَ فَقُلْتُ لَهُ أَلاَّ كَانَ هَذَا قَبْلَ السَّاعَةِ فَقَالَ أَرَدْتُ بِذَلِكَ أَدَبَكَ ثُمَّ قَالَ سَمِعْتُ أَبَا عَبْدِ الله (عَلَيْهِ السَّلاَم) يَقُولُ أَيُّمَا رَجُلٍ مُؤْمِنٍ دَخَلَ عَلَى أَخِيهِ وَهُوَ صَائِمٌ فَسَأَلَهُ الأَكْلَ فَلَمْ يُخْبِرْهُ بِصِيَامِهِ لِيَمُنَّ عَلَيْهِ بِإِفْطَارِهِ كَتَبَ الله جَلَّ ثَنَاؤُهُ لَهُ بِذَلِكَ الْيَوْمِ صِيَامَ سَنَةٍ.
